| Description of the problem | My 77 year old mother was driving vehicle on highway 159 in maryville, il when the engine stalled. She was able to pull off roadway. Engine light appeared. Turned vehicle off and then restarted. Went to dealership where they used some type of hand held tester. It showed code po335 which is crankshaft position sensor. This happen two days later when turning into parking lot. Same as above. This is a very dangerous thing to happen especially driving 45 mph. |
